The MN-2000 came in all three of the Drake 4 Series finishes. It came out in 1966, two years before the advent of the B-Line with it's epoxy paint, and so would have had the smooth enamel finish of the R-4A and earlier pieces. It also had the bare aluminum border around the front panel edges.

It got the "textured" epoxy finish of the B-Line around 1968, and then the "spackle" finish of the C-Line in 1973, along with the "borderless" front panel paint.

So you could paint it with either enamel or epoxy if it has the front panel border - OR - with the spackle finish of the C-Line if it has the borderless front panel and you'd be correct!
